### Background The final season of 'The Handmaid's Tale' sees June continuing her fight against Gilead, even as the lines between ally and enemy blur. Nick's involvement with Gilead, coupled with Lawrence's complex motivations, sets the stage for their ultimate sacrifices.
### The Sacrifice Lawrence orchestrates a plan to bomb a plane of High Commanders, but circumstances force him to board the plane himself. In a shocking turn, Nick joins him, solidifying his choice to remain loyal to Gilead, despite his love for June. This decision underscores the show's theme that power within Gilead comes at a moral cost.
### Impact on June June witnesses the explosion, grappling with the loss of Nick and the knowledge that he chose Gilead over her. This moment fuels her resolve to fight for a better future for her daughter, Nichole, and all those oppressed by Gilead.
